How Do I Calculate The Total Cost Of A DIY Project Including Labor And Permits?
Gathering question image...
Introduction
Calculating the total cost of a DIY project involves careful assessment of crucial factors like materials, labor, and permits. Learning to estimate these costs accurately is vital for effective budget management and preventing unexpected expenses during your home improvement projects.
Estimating Material Costs for Your DIY Project
The initial step in determining your DIY project expenses is identifying all necessary materials. This includes essentials like wood, nails, paint, and any special tools or hardware. Precise estimations of material costs are fundamental for laying a solid budget foundation.
- Create a detailed list of all materials needed for your DIY project.
- Investigate prices for these materials at nearby hardware stores or on reputable online platforms.
- Incorporate a contingency percentage, typically between 10 to 20 percent, into the total to cover unexpected materials costs or waste.
Calculating Labor Costs for Your Project
When planning on hiring assistance for your DIY project, it is crucial to factor in labor costs within your overall budget. These costs may cover professional services or compensating friends who help. Rates can fluctuate based on project complexity and duration, as well as local market rates.
- Estimate the total number of hours required to complete the project.
- Research local labor rates, such as hourly wages for skilled tradespeople or assistants.
- Multiply the estimated hours by the average local labor rate to calculate total labor costs.
Including Permit Fees in Your Budget
Depending on the scope of your DIY project, you may need to secure permits from local authorities. This is especially common for substantial renovations or structural modifications. Ensure to include these fees, as they can considerably affect your total costs.
- Consult your local building department to identify necessary permits for your project.
- Ascertain the associated fees for these permits, which can significantly differ by location.
- Incorporate permit fees into your total project budget.
Calculating Your Total DIY Project Cost
After estimating material costs, labor expenses, and permit fees, it's time to compute your complete project cost. Summing these individual components will provide a clear insight into your financial obligations for the DIY endeavor.
- Add your total material costs together.
- Combine your total labor costs.
- Include your total permit fees.
- The overall total will represent your total expenditure for the DIY project.
